The army made safe a quantity of unstable picric acid at a chemist in Tipperary today.
Shortly before midday, an Army Bomb Disposal Team was deployed to the scene at Main Square, Thurles, where the unstable chemical had been found during a routine audit of chemicals.
It was removed to waste ground by the team and a controlled explosion was carried out in order to make the chemical safe.
The scene was declared safe at 12.30pm.
